09/03-- Purdue and Rolls-Royce today (Thursday, 9/4) officially kicked off their joint University Technology Center to improve jet engines and develop advanced propulsion systems for future "hypersonic" aircraft. The event took place at the recently renovated High Pressure Lab at the university's Maurice J. Zucrow Laboratories. From left to right are: Tom Martin, a graduate student majoring in aeronautics and astronautics; Linda P.B. Katehi, dean of the Schools of Engineering; Rolls-Royce executive Michael Howse; Purdue Provost Sally Mason; and Stephen Heister, a professor of aeronautics and astronautics.
